Most decent phones are much more expensive than any of the action cameras available and tend to break if you just drop them. I would never strap my android to my body and go ride. One good spill and the screen would be toast. Plus that picture quality was terrible. If that's the bar thats being used for quality there are 15 dollar cameras out there that will do a similar job.
Phone cameras are simply not up to the task of capturing hi speed sports and should be used only for their intended purpose, sexting!
